Tel Aviv, Israel, known for its vibrant tech scene and innovative startups, has become a global hub for advancements in Linux networks. The city's startup culture, supported by a skilled workforce and a dynamic ecosystem, has propelled it to the forefront of technological innovation. Many tech companies in Tel Aviv rely heavily on Linux networks due to their flexibility, security, and open-source nature. Linux, an operating system kernel that serves as the foundation for a wide range of software applications, is favored by developers for its versatility and ability to be customized to meet specific needs. In Tel Aviv, Linux user groups and meetups are common, providing a platform for developers, engineers, and enthusiasts to collaborate, share knowledge, and stay updated on the latest trends in Linux technology. These gatherings foster a sense of community and experimentation, further fueling innovation in Linux networks. Meanwhile, in Cameroon, a focus on education is driving efforts to empower the next generation with the skills and knowledge needed to succeed in a rapidly evolving digital world. The Cameroonian government has recognized the importance of education in driving socioeconomic development and is investing in initiatives to improve the quality of education across the country. One such initiative is the integration of technology in classrooms to enhance learning outcomes and prepare students for a competitive job market. By introducing digital tools and resources, Cameroon is equipping students with valuable digital literacy skills that are essential in today's technology-driven society. Furthermore, Cameroon is working to expand access to education, particularly in underserved communities, by building schools, training teachers, and providing scholarships to students in need. By prioritizing education, Cameroon is laying the foundation for a more prosperous and inclusive society, where all individuals have the opportunity to reach their full potential.
